Rowe Announces State Grants for 85th District Schools
August 17, 2026
HARRISBURG – Rep. David H. Rowe (R-Snyder/Union/Mifflin/Juniata) today announced the Pennsylvania Commission on Crime and Delinquency (PCCD) approved grants to bolster school safety. Several public schools that serve students in 85th District could benefit from the grants.
“Protecting student safety is essential to delivering a high quality education that supports academic success,” Rowe said. “I’m encouraged to see these funds invested in students across both traditional and career and technical schools, ensuring our future leaders gain the tools, confidence, and opportunities they need to thrive in the years ahead.”
The following grants are available to public schools, contingent upon filing an application for the funds:
• Mifflin County Academy of Science and Technology, $70,000.
• Mifflin County School District, $298,896.
• Mifflinburg Area School District, $175,713.
• Midd-West School District, $184,601.
• Selinsgrove Area School District, $200,894.
• SUN Area Technical Institute, $70,000.
• Juniata County School District, $199,735.
• Lewisburg Area School District, $177,689.
The funding from this grant program may be used to help address school violence and improve school security, including costs associated with the training and compensation of security personnel.
